    Le Bosquet

    Posted by hindse 11 July 2012

    Putange is in the Normandy area which saw much of the fighting after the D-Day landings. A pretty French riverside village with bars, bakers etc, completely unspoilt by too much tourism. The real jewel in the crown here is "Le Bosquet" a B&B overlooking the village. Resembling a small chateau this residence charms in every way. Excellent bedrooms (five in all each individually decorated) good continental breakfast and excellent decor throughout. The hosts Richard and Magda Green are always on hand to give advice on the various places to visit, like the area of Suisse Normandie, but leave time to enjoy their garden and wildlife.
